OBITUARY
Published: Waycross Journal-Herald (GA) - Monday, August 15, 1949, page 5.
Mrs. Hester B. Bullard, 83, died Sunday afternoon at the residence of her daughter, Mrs. Renna Strickland, in Blackshear.
Besides her daughter she is survived by three sons, Tom Bullard of Millwood, Willie Bullard of Manor, Lemuel Bullard of Waycross; two sisters, Mrs. Alice Smith of Waresboro, Mrs. Daisy Rackley of Ocala, Fla.; one brother, Count Brantley of Millwood; 10 grandchildren and 22 great-grandchildren.
Funeral services are to be held at 4 o'clock Tuesday afternoon at Hargraves Chapel. Interment will be in Hargraves Cemetery. The funeral procession will leave Mincy Funeral Home at 2 o'clock.
Mincy Funeral Home is in charge of arrangements.
FUNERAL NOTICE
(SOURCE: Waycross Journal-Herald (GA) – Wednesday, August 17, 1949, page 10)
Funeral services for Mrs. Hester B. Bullard, who died in Blackshear Sunday, were held Tuesday afternoon at Hargraves Chapel near Millwood.
The Rev. Clifford Bailey and Mrs. Mamie Bennett officiated and interment was in Hargraves Cemetery.
Pallbearers were Willie Bennett, G. C. Bennett, E. H. King, B. F. Strickland, A. C. Strickland and Coy Bullard.
Mincy Funeral Home was in charge of arrangements.
